Excess Inbound Capacity Issues

The answer to your question depends on many factors. Some of them include: the industry you are in; the amonut of excess capacity; historical information regading direct marketing campaigns and how they impacted inbound call-volume; are your agents outbound capable; are you focussed on customer-retention or acquisition? There are many other factors that contribute to adequately addressing this question.
